VaultChatFormatter

This plugin formats the chat, using one template format, and has placeholders for a player's prefix/suffix which can be used in the template. (by Majekdor)

    Hex codes were added in 1.16. Most chat for matters support them. You can use the search term “Chat formatter” when looking for a plugin. I like a specific fork of VaultChatFormatter, though it doesn’t have too many features. A good choice if you’re using essentials would be EssentialsChat. There are some other pretty nice chat formatting plugins online that I don’t know off the top of my head.
